什么是 GitHub 吸星大法?
GitHub 吸星大法,简单来说,就是利用 GitHub 平台的各种功能和社区资源,以高效管理和提升你的开源项目。在这个信息爆炸的时代,如何筛选和获取有价值的资源,成为了开发者的重要课题。通过吸星大法,我们可以集成多种资源,优化项目管理,并且增强团队合作。
吸星大法的基本原则
- 借鉴他人:不要羞于学习他人的优秀代码和项目管理方法。
- 利用标签:合理使用 GitHub 标签功能,以便快速分类和查找。
- 参与社区:加入相关的开发者社区,互相学习和分享资源。
如何在 GitHub 上实践吸星大法
1. 寻找灵感
- 搜索优质项目:使用 GitHub 的搜索功能,寻找与自己项目相关的开源代码。
- 分析明星项目:关注和分析那些获得较高 star 的项目,从中汲取灵感。
2. 参与贡献
- 提交 Pull Request:对他人的项目做出贡献,能够提高你的影响力和技术水平。
- 写作文档:完善项目文档,帮助他人理解项目,同时也提升自己的技术水平。
3. 管理你的项目
- 使用 Issues:合理利用 Issues 功能进行项目管理和任务分配。
- 设定里程碑:为项目设定清晰的里程碑,以确保项目按时推进。
4. 社区互动
- 参加开源活动:定期参加线上和线下的开源活动,与更多开发者交流。
- 分享你的经验:通过写博客或参与演讲分享你的开发经验。
吸星大法的工具和技巧
1. GitHub Actions
GitHub Actions 是一款强大的自动化工具,帮助你实现 CI/CD 工作流。通过自动化测试和部署,可以有效减少手动操作的错误。
2. 项目看板
利用 GitHub 提供的项目看板功能,清晰展示项目进展,方便团队协作。
3. 代码评审
鼓励团队成员之间进行代码评审,确保代码质量,并且提升团队的整体技术水平。
FAQ(常见问题解答)
Q1: 什么是 GitHub 吸星大法?
A: GitHub 吸星大法是指利用 GitHub 的多种功能和社区资源来优化项目管理的技巧,重点在于学习和借鉴他人的优秀做法。
Q2: 如何在 GitHub 上找到优秀的开源项目?
A: 你可以通过 GitHub 的搜索功能、关注热门项目(高 star 数)、加入开源社区来发现优秀项目。
Q3: 吸星大法适合哪些开发者?
A: 吸星大法适合所有希望提升自己项目管理能力的开发者,特别是刚入门的开发者以及需要参与团队协作的开发者。
Q4: 使用 GitHub 吸星大法有什么具体好处?
A: 通过吸星大法,你可以提高自己的代码质量,增强项目管理能力,扩大自己的开发者网络,同时获得更多学习机会。
Q5: 有哪些成功运用吸星大法的案例?
A: 很多知名开源项目如 React、Vue.js 等,都运用了吸星大法,通过借鉴和改进提升了项目质量,吸引了大量开发者参与。
总结
通过在 GitHub 上运用吸星大法,我们可以有效提升项目管理能力和代码质量,借助社区资源更快成长。无论你是新手还是老手,掌握这些技巧都能帮助你在开源的道路上走得更远。
正文完